Second
Jogger Sexually Assaulted
While On Bay Trail
Berkeley,
California (Wednesday, December 10, 2003)
– On 12-10-03 at approximately
6:43 am, a woman was sexually assaulted while jogging alone along the
Bay Trail. This part of the
Bay Trail parallels West Frontage Road between Gilman Street and
University Avenue. She was
approached from behind by a suspect who tackled her into the bushes
where the sexual assault occurred. The victim was able to get away and
run into the street and flag down passing cars for help. An SUV stopped
and the two occupants saw and chased the suspect into the park area.
The victim was picked up by another passing car and was taken to
a nearby payphone where the police were called.
The occupants of the SUV were not able to catch the suspect and
left the scene prior to police arriving.
Officers
made contact with the victim and immediately began to search the area
where the suspect was last seen. The
search utilized over 20 officers, a police boat, dirt bike, a CHP plane
and helicopter and Oakland Police K-9 units.
The search lasted several hours, but no suspect was found.
The
suspect is described as a:
Hispanic Male Adult or
White Male Adult, late 20’s, 5’10” - 6’00”, Medium Build.
He was last seen wearing a gray sweatshirt and dark pants.

This
case is similar to an attempted sexual assault case in the same area on
11-9-03. Detectives
are investigating this to determine if it may be same suspect.
